Crypto CEO Chris Larsen Donates $500,000 to Support Political Moderate in Supervisors Race

The donation supports moderate Democrat Theo Ellington’s bid to replace progressive supervisor Shamann Walton in November.

Vehicles pass by City Hall in San Francisco on Aug. 8, 2023. Founder of cryptocurrency company Ripple Labs, Chris Larsen, has given millions to support Mayor Daniel Lurie’s political campaign, charter reform and policing initiatives earlier this year.  (Beth LaBerge/KQED)

Crypto billionaire Chris Larsen poured a record $500,000 into the campaign to elect Theo Ellington, a moderate Democrat, to the San Francisco Board of Supervisors this week, according to new finance filings. 

The donation is believed to be the largest in San Francisco history to a third-party supporting a single candidate. 

Larsen made the contribution, first reported by the San Francisco Standard, through a newly created political action committee called: “From the Neighborhood, For the City, Supporting Theo Ellington For District 10 Supervisor.”

While individuals are limited to donating just $500 directly to a single candidate, donors routinely pour larger amounts into PACs. Ahead of the June election, billionaire Michael Moritz donated $250,000 to a GrowSF political action committee supporting District 4 supervisor Alan Wong.
